Address

D8NFiMsZwzHAouyPuhZNRicdrZq8jcb9ysCopy

Total Received

768516.5101879 DOGE

Total Sent

768516.5101879 DOGE

№ Transactions

18

Final Balance

0 DOGE

Transactions
Filter